FREE LORETTA SANCHEZ
(Mr. PALLONE asked and was given permission to address the House for
1 minute.)
Mr. PALLONE. Mr. Speaker, the Republican leadership this morning will
bring up a resolution that allows the House to adjourn this weekend and
not return until the end of January, and the purpose of that basically
is to avoid addressing the issue of Loretta Sanchez' election and the
ongoing investigation.
This House should not adjourn until it ends this witch-hunt of
Congresswoman Loretta Sanchez' election. The Republican leadership has
not been able to prove that there was any illegality involved in this
election. Congresswoman Sanchez won her California election fair and
square. The Republicans are simply wasting a lot of money, over
$500,000 in taxpayer dollars, to try to prove a case that they have not
been able to prove.
It is all because Republicans are trying to harass and intimidate
Hispanic voters because they voted in overwhelming numbers for
Democratic candidates in the last congressional election. Let us free
Loretta Sanchez and put an end to this witch-hunt. It is not proper for
this House to adjourn until this investigation is concluded and
stopped.
